1. Sleep is good

Yes, this seems like a strange place to start. But everything starts with this.

One of the first things we tend to do when we think about improving our own lives is to think about the things that we need to add to our to-do list. This is dangerous – a richer life does not necessarily mean a busier life!

Beyond this, sleep is important for a number of health reasons, and being well-rested will definitely help you to enjoy the activities and people that are already a part of your life. You can always start reaching your goals and doing whatever it is you want to do after you’ve got at least 7 hours of sleep every night.

If you don’t take care of your health first by getting a good night’s sleep, not only do you have a weaker immunity, you’re also less awake during the day. You just won’t be able to move forward in the right mind if you’re constantly fatigued. [Read: 13 sexy benefits of sleeping naked you had no idea about]

12. Be patient

Good things come to those who wait. This is a daily reminder for you to be patient. No matter what you wish to achieve, and how much effort you put in, life takes time to unfold. You can’t rush something, even if it’s as simple as boiling an egg or something as huge as becoming a life coach who changes billions of lives.

Only patience can help you realize your dreams, and allow you the pleasure of enjoying every minute of your life, at the same time. When you feel anxious or impatient, breathe in and out for a few minutes and compose yourself. Life is too much fun to rush past in a hurry!

23. Stop reaching for perfection

You will never achieve anything if you always reach for perfection. As ironic as that sounds, perfection is a double-edged sword that limits you from reaching your goals and living your most authentic life.

Not to mention, it’s an impossible standard you’re setting for yourself because perfection is unquantifiable. No matter how well you do something, there will always be a better way to do it tomorrow.

Stop fearing rejection and failure, and realize those are both opportunities for growth and betterment. The more you put pressure on yourself to be perfect, the more you won’t successfully reach your goals.
